A dog is 3/8lb heavier than a squirrel. The squirrel is 3/8lb lighter than the ferret. If the weight of the ferret is 1/2lb , find the weight of the dog?

( x+3/8)+(1/2-3/8)+1/2 was the equation I came up with

Answers

Answered by Steve
You did not come up with an equation. You have an expression, and it does not provide a value for x.

d = s + 3/8
s = f - 3/8
so, d = f - 3/8 + 3/8 = f
the dog weighs the same as the ferret, or 1/2 lb
